POST OFFICE NOTICE

THE HONGKONG DAILY PRESS, SATURDAY, AUGUST 1st, 1908.

Monday, the 3rd inst., being a Bank Holiday, the Post Office will be open for one hour from 8 till 9 s.m. There will be a collection and a delivery of tellers as on Sunday§.

The Money Order Office will be entirely closed. In the event of the arrival of French mail from Europe, the Post Office will he open for one hour for the delivery thoroof,

The Farra, with the French mail, of the &d July, left Saigon on Friday, the 31st July, at 7 a.m, and may be expected here on or about Monday, the 3rd instant, at daylight. This packet 1 rings replies to letters despatared fem Hongkong-an the 2nd June.

VESSELS EXPECTED

THE FRENCH MAIL

The MM. str. Yarra with the french Mail of the 5th alt, and Mails from Laibo of the 4th it. left Saigon on Frida the 31st ult. at 7.8.m., and may be expeed to arrive here on Monday morning, the Inst and will leave for Shanghal and Japan the same afternoon.

THE CANADIAN MAIL, The C.P.E str. Empress of Initia lef You over on the 15th r]), m-fer Hongkong the usual ports of call.
